East Elementary School has taken the Clean Campus Program to a new level.
East Elementary School in Cullman County has taken their Clean Campus Program to a new level! At the direction of teacher Anna Katherine Parsons, East Elementary is working hard to ensure their campus stands out as clean and green for the 2015-2016 school year!
Parsons coordinated a Clean Campus Day in May to wrap up their 2014-2015 school year. The day kicked off with my 30-minute Clean Campus presentation; then each grade was dismissed to their assigned task. The younger grades cleaned windows and doors, as well as watered plants and helped in pulling weeds. The older grades worked to clean the parking lots and did other litter pickups around the campus. The cleanup was quite an impressive team effort!
East Elementary has participated in the Clean Campus Program for many years now, and always participates in Alabama PALS’ scrapbook competition every fall. Their scrapbook this year will have an abundance of new material after their successful cleanup day!
Congratulations to East Elementary for taking their Clean Campus Program so seriously!
